Heart disease starts with lesions and cracks that form in blood vessel walls. The second stage is a cholesterol which the body begins to deposit in these cracked stressed vessels in an attempt to repair the damage. With poor diet this cholesterol builds up and clogs the blood vessel causing heart attack or stroke. A low fat high fiber diet is the best preventative measure and you can never start too soon. Children who eat a heart healthy diet will grow up to be heart healthy adults. If you are older starting a heart healthy diet will still benefit you.
